Recently, American YouTuber Karl Conrad, known for his vibrant tech and lifestyle channel with nearly one million subscribers, took delivery of a stunning 2025 RS6 Avant Performance model that might just be the most eye-catching example we’ve seen so far.

Conrad has built his audience around the latest gadgets and lifestyle upgrades, making the RS6 a natural extension of his identity. His new ride is a true one-of-a-kind configuration, carefully crafted through Audi Exclusive to elevate every exciting element about the RS6.

What truly sets this car apart is its captivating paint job—a custom Camouflage Green that’s as mesmerizing as it is fierce. Under direct sunlight, the color flashes to an olive hue, while in the shade, it deepens into the tones of a lush forest, and at night, it transforms into a sleek gunmetal grey. This is no ordinary wagon; it feels like a military-grade piece of art, perfectly balancing practicality with an aesthetic that can make heads turn at 300 km/h.

Karl’s RS6 is packed with jaw-dropping details, and the spec sheet reads like a dream for anyone who’s ever fantasized about customizing their own Audi Exclusive project. From the Cognac Valcona Leather seats adorned with grey stitching to the Carbon Matte Optics Package and the eye-catching 22-inch wheels, every inch of this vehicle reflects luxury and performance.

The RS6 itself is an extraordinary character in the automotive landscape. Born in the late nineties as a stealth alternative to BMW’s M cars and Mercedes’ AMG powerhouses, it evolved into Audi’s halo model—the one car that petrolheads rally behind, even if they wouldn’t consider owning another Audi.

The appeal is crystal clear. Imagine a wagon that pumps out a staggering 621 horsepower from a twin-turbo V8 engine, with quattro all-wheel drive, ample room for a baby seat, and a presence that can command attention from Monaco to Michigan.

Yet, there’s a bittersweet irony: wagons are virtually extinct in North America. While brands like Audi, Mercedes, and Volvo cling to them for enthusiasts, most buyers still gravitate towards SUVs. This is why the likes of Conrad’s bespoke RS6 stand out—they are not just rare; they are a bold statement against automotive conformity.
